Red Alert Sirens Triggered in Northern Israel, Residents Urged to Seek Shelter

Red alert sirens echoed across two regions in Northern Israel, prompting authorities to issue a warning for residents to take immediate shelter. The alert, which spanned the Confrontation Line and Upper Galilee areas, was reported by multiple sources and confirmed by local authorities.

According to eyewitness accounts, the sirens began sounding around 8:45 a.m. local time, prompting residents to quickly seek shelter. Military forces in the region were reportedly on high alert, with troops mobilized in the event of a potential conflict.

The Confrontation Line, a buffer zone established along the Lebanese border, has been a focus of Israeli defense efforts in recent years. The region has seen periodic clashes with Hizbollah militants, fueling tensions in the region. The Upper Galilee, a predominantly Jewish region, has also experienced sporadic rocket fire from neighboring Lebanon, prompting concerns among local residents.
